About the Role:
We are seeking a dedicated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) to join our Senior Behavioral Health Unit. This 15-bed inpatient psychiatric unit specializes in treating elderly patients with mental health conditions such as depression, anxiety, b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, and more. You will work closely with a care team including RNs, mental health technicians, a psychiatrist, a psychiatric nurse practitioner, a social worker, and a recreational therapist.
Signing Bonus: $7,500
Bonus Description: One-time sign-on bonus paid upon hire.
This is a full-time day shift role, with a weekend program schedule of Friday to Sunday consisting of three 12-hour shifts.
Key Responsibilities:
- Assist physicians and RNs with patient care, including medication administration, monitoring, and documentation.
- Provide direct care to patients while maintaining a compassionate and safe environment.
- Observe and document patient conditions, including changes in physical or mental health.
- Restock patient rooms and maintain equipment to ensure a safe and efficient work environment.
- Collaborate with a multidisciplinary team to deliver high-quality, patient-centered care.
- Perform all duties in accordance with applicable scope and standards of practice.
- Active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license in the state of Wisconsin.
- Experience or interest in behavioral health or psychiatric nursing.
- Strong team collaboration and communication skills.
